Cream rising at Copa del Rey

Published on August 7th, 2014

Palma de Mallorca, Spain (August 7, 2014) – After finishing the fourth racing day, the rankings begin to give clues about the candidates to win the title of the 33rd Copa del Rey MAPFRE.

Today’s menu consisted of two windward / leeward races for all classes except for Gaastra IRC 1, BMW ORC 1 and BMW ORC 2, which sailed a 20.93 nautical miles coastal race around the bay of Palma. The one-design classes Nespresso X-35 and Herbalife J80 have reached eight races sailed, so all the teams can discard their worst result of the week.

At the top of the provisional overall there are Americans “Shockwave” (Gaastra IRC 0) and “Quantum Racing” (Barclays 52 Super Series), Italians “Hurakan” (Gaastra IRC 1) and “Lelagain” (Nespresso X-35), Russian “Bronenosec” (Gazprom Swan 60) and Spanish “Rats on Fire” (BMW ORC 1), “Movistar” (BMW ORC 2) and “Noticia” (Herbalife J80). With just two days for the end, the candidates to the title begin to stand out at the top of the rankings, but nothing is decided yet.

The thermal wind was on time again to its appointment with the fleet, with intensities between nine and 12 knots all day long, always from the south-southwest. A similar scenario is expected for the rest of the week.

Gaastra IRC 0
American “Bella Mente” and Italian “Robertissima III” took today’s victories in the class Gaastra IRC 0, but neither Hap Fauth nor Roberto Tomasini managed to get improve “Shockwave’s” week. George Sakellaris’ team ends the fourth day of competition two points ahead of his nearest rival after seven races. The victory is still open.

Gaastra IRC 1
The coastal race didn’t help either “Hurakan’s” nine rivals to neutralize the extraordinary performance of Giuseppe Parodi’s TP52. The Italian boat won again, both in real and on compensated time, finishing the coastal race ahead of Austrian “Aquila” and French “Team Vision Future”. The undisputed leader in the class Gaastra IRC 1 has scored a third as their worst result of the week. A material breakage onboard “Aifos” prevented the Spanish Army’s boat to complete the race.

Gazprom Swan 60

Vladimir Liubomirov’s “Bronenosec” moved today two steps forward towards Gazprom Swan 60 title. The Russian boat won the first race of the day and was second in the next one. He is first overall with 13 points. His direct threat, “Petite Flamme”, (5-3 today) has 25 points, and “Spirit of Europe” closes the provisional podium after an irregular day (6-1).

Barclays 52 Super Series
American “Quantum Racing” has once again become the best of the day in the class Barclays 52 Super Series, with a first and a second place. The defending champions, skippered by Ed Baird, gets back on track after their sixth place in the coastal race yesterday, and is leading its class after seven races sailed, six points ahead of Swedish “Rán” (3-1) and nine ahead of Italian “Azzurra” (2-5).

BMW ORC 1
German “Earlybird” managed to score their first victory of the week after winning today’s coastal race in the class BMW ORC 1. Hendrik Brandis Swan 45 completed the race in just over three hours, beating “Elena Nova” by 22 seconds and “Rats on Fire” by 25. After seven races, “Rats on Fire”, skippered by Manuel Doreste, is still leading 12 points ahead of his nearest rival.

BMW ORC 2
Enrique Terol’s “Movistar” was also good on the coastal race. The Synergy 40 skippered by Pedro Campos was the only boat out of the BMW ORC 2 fleet which completed today’s course in less than four hours. Second in the finish line was “Varador 2000” and third “Airlan Aermec”, which occupy the provisional podium overall the same order. “Movistar” has won six out of seven possible victories.

Nespresso X-35
The Nespresso X-35 class has already sailed eight races, so the 12 teams in the class discarded their worst result of the week. Italian Alessandro Solerio’s “Lelagain” discarded his seventh place from the second day and takes advantage of today’s good results (1-2) to stretch his lead in the overall. He is now leading six points ahead of “Puerto Deportivo Benalmádena” (6-1 today). Third is Finnish “Audi e-tron” (2-4 today).

Herbalife J80
“Noticia” skippered by Jose Maria Torcida is keeping up the pace, and has his second perfect day in a row: two wins today, two yesterday. After applying the discard, “Noticia” discards a fifth, finishing today as solid leader ten points ahead of Carlos Martinez’s “Movistar” (3-2 today). Third is Javier Padrón’s “Herbalife”, who didn’t have his best day today (6-6).

The competition will continue tomorrow with two windward / leeward races scheduled for all classes. The first start of the day will be at 13h00.

The 33rd Copa del Rey MAPFRE is organized by the Real Club Náutico de Palma and will take place from August 2nd to the 9th, 2014.
